A growing recruitment agency in Milton Keynes is seeking a driven Recruitment Consultant to join their team. This role involves managing an Industrial temp desk, developing relationships with existing and new clients.

The ideal candidate should possess excellent communication skills and thrive in a target-driven environment. The agency offers a competitive commission scheme, career progression, and a supportive culture.

How to prepare for a job interview at Osborne Appointments

Know Your Stuff

Before the interview, make sure you understand the recruitment industry, especially in the industrial sector. Research the agency's clients and their needs. This will help you demonstrate your knowledge and show that you're genuinely interested in the role.

Show Off Your Communication Skills

As a Recruitment Consultant, communication is key. Practice articulating your thoughts clearly and confidently. Prepare examples of how you've successfully built relationships in the past, as this will highlight your ability to connect with clients and candidates alike.

Be Target-Driven

Since this role is target-driven, come prepared with examples of how you've met or exceeded targets in previous roles. Discuss your strategies for achieving goals and how you stay motivated, as this will resonate well with the agency's culture.

Ask Insightful Questions

At the end of the interview, don’t shy away from asking questions. Inquire about the agency's growth plans, team dynamics, and what success looks like in this role. This shows your enthusiasm and helps you gauge if the agency is the right fit for you.
